Run-on Sentences

• Sentences that are too long.• More than one complete idea in a sentence-

be careful!

Page 20: Writing Good Sentences – Part 4 Run-on Sentences

Examples

• The TV is big, it was expensive.• The TV is big. It was expensive.• The TV is big, so it was expensive.• Correct this sentence in two different ways– The sky is blue, there is lots of sunshine.– The sky is blue. There is lots of sunshine.– The sky is blue, and there is lots of sunshine.
